print("服务器已启动,地址为: http://localhost:" + str(PORT)) httpd.serve_forever() ``` 以上代码中,我们指定了Web服务器监听的端口号为8000,并使用`SimpleHTTPRequestHandler`来处理HTTP请求。`TCPServer`类用于创建基于TCP协议的服务器,并将其绑定到指定的IP地址和端口。最后,通过`serve_forever()`方法启...
1.利用Python自带的包可以建立简单的web服务器: python -m Web服务器模块 [端口号,默认8000] 如果是python 2.x的系列里面 这样启动一个web服务器: python -m SimpleHTTPServer 8080 如果是Python 3,用下面的语句也可以启动一个http服务: python3 -m http.server 8000 2.然后就可以在其他主机下载文件了: wget...
一,使用python开启一个web服务器 自带的simple_server模块开启一个服务器; from wsgiref.simple_server import make_server #导入simple_server模块 #定义一个application,遵循wsgi协议; def app(env, start_response): #服务器接收到的客户端请求都会存储在env中,再传入到app进行处理,处理后再返回 start_response("...
在开始之前,请确保您已经安装了Python环境。接下来,我们将分步骤介绍如何搭建一个简单的Python Web服务器,并使用Django框架进行开发。第一步:安装DjangoDjango是一个高级Python Web框架,它使得Web开发更加快速和简单。您可以使用pip(Python的包管理器)来安装Django。打开终端或命令提示符,并输入以下命令:pip install djan...
python 启动简单web服务器 有时我们在开发web静态页面时,需要一个web服务器来测试。 这时可以利用python提供的web服务器来实现。 1、在命令行下进入某个目录 2、在该目录下运行命令: python -m SimpleHTTPServer 3、在浏览器打开 http://localhost:8000/路径...
(1)在终端或命令提示符中进入要作为服务器根目录的文件夹。 (2)输入以下命令启动Web服务器: python -m http.server [端口号] 如果不指定端口号,默认端口号为8000。 使用第三方框架Flask搭建Web服务器 Flask是一个轻量级的Python Web框架,可以用于构建功能丰富的Web应用程序。使用Flask搭建Web服务器的步骤如下: ...
为浏览器发送数据的函数 1. 当浏览器链接到网站服务器的时候 代码语言:javascript 复制 defservice_client(new_socket):request=new_socket.recv(1024)print(request) 2. 向浏览器发送http数据 如果浏览器在接收完http协议数据之后遇到了换行,自动将下面的数据转成网站内容body中去 ...
启动Web服务器 最后,我们需要启动Web服务器,让它监听在某个端口上,等待客户端的请求。我们可以使用socketserver模块中的TCPServer类来启动Web服务器。 代码语言:python 代码运行次数:0 复制 Cloud Studio代码运行 PORT=8000withsocketserver.TCPServer(("",PORT),RequestHandler)ashttpd: ...
要学习 Web 开发,首先要明白什么是 HTTP 协议,因为 Web 开发就是建立在 HTTP 协议之上的。 在浏览器地址栏输入网址https://www.jd.com/将得到京东商城首页。我们在浏览器页面中看到的所有数据都是服务器通过 HTTP 协议传输过来的。 HTTP 协议中文叫超文本传输协议,可以拆分成三部分理解:超文本、传输、协议。